Windshield weatherstripping R&R

Does anyone know how to replace the wetherstripping on the front
windshield of a 98 Civic without removing the glass?
Is it glued in?

Re: Windshield weatherstripping R&R

Thanks for the replies.
I have checked with the dealer and some windshield installers
and the glass does have to come out.
The molding does come with the glass and wraps around the back side.
I wish there was a universal "tee" molding I could find and glue back in
so I could cut the existing one out. I'm painting and would like to
do it all. I'll just pull it back and paint underneath as far as I can.
